Israel's War against Midian

1The Lord said to Moses,

2“Before you die, make sure that the Midianites are punished for what they did to Israel.”

3Then Moses told the people, “The Lord wants to punish the Midianites. So tell our men to prepare for battle.

4Each tribe will send 1,000 men to fight.”

5Twelve thousand men were picked from the tribes of Israel, and after they were prepared for battle,

6Moses sent them off to war. Phinehas the son of Eleazar went with them and took along some things from the sacred tent and the trumpets for sounding the battle signal.

7The Israelites fought against the Midianites, just as the Lord had commanded Moses. They killed all the men,

8including Balaam son of Beor and the five Midianite kings, Evi, Rekem, Zur, Hur, and Reba.

9The Israelites captured every woman and child, then led away the Midianites' cattle and sheep, and took everything else that belonged to them.

10They also burned down the Midianite towns and villages.

11Israel's soldiers gathered together everything they had taken from the Midianites, including the captives and the animals.

12-13Then they returned to their own camp in the hills of Moab across the Jordan River from Jericho, where Moses, Eleazar, and the other Israelite leaders met the troops outside camp.
